推荐使用:Apache Sling Scripting JSP 标准标签库

推荐使用:Apache Sling Scripting JSP 标准标签库

sling-org-apache-sling-scripting-jsp-jstlApache Sling Scripting JSP Standard Tag Library项目地址:https://gitcode.com/gh_mirrors/sl/sling-org-apache-sling-scripting-jsp-jstl

1、项目介绍

Apache Sling Scripting JSP Standard Tag Library 是一个强大的开源组件,它是 Apache Sling 项目的一部分,专注于提高基于 JavaServer Pages (JSP) 的应用程序开发效率和性能。这个模块专门提供了对 JSTL(JavaServer Pages Standard Tag Library)的支持,让开发者能更便捷地利用标准标签进行页面逻辑处理。

2、项目技术分析

该项目的核心在于它的 JSTL 实现,它允许开发者通过简单的标签而不是复杂的脚本来处理常见的任务,如迭代、条件判断、URL 处理等。Sling 的这一特性使得开发过程更加简洁、可读性更强,并且提高了代码的可维护性。此外,该库与 Apache Sling 框架完美集成,充分利用了其灵活性和可扩展性,支持多种脚本语言和内容存储后端。

3、项目及技术应用场景

Apache Sling Scripting JSP 标准标签库非常适合以下场景:

  • Web 应用开发:在构建动态、数据驱动的 Web 应用时,利用 JSTL 可以简化视图层的编程。
  • MVC 模式实现:配合 Sling 的模型-视图-控制器架构,JSTL 提供了一种高效的方式将业务逻辑从视图中分离出来。
  • CMS 系统:由于 Sling 对内容管理系统的友好支持,这款库特别适用于需要用户界面高度自定义的内容管理系统开发。
  • 企业级应用:在大型企业的软件项目中,Sling JSP 的标准化和灵活性可以增强团队协作,降低复杂性。

4、项目特点

  • 易用性:提供了一系列预定义的标签,使得 JSP 页面更易于编写和理解。
  • 兼容性:与广泛的 JSP 和 Servlet 规范版本兼容,包括最新的标准。
  • 性能优化:经过优化的实现,保证了在处理大量请求时的高效性能。
  • 社区支持:作为 Apache 软件基金会的项目,享有活跃的社区支持,持续更新和完善。
  • 模块化设计:轻松与其他 Apache Sling 组件结合使用,实现灵活的应用架构。

总的来说,Apache Sling Scripting JSP Standard Tag Library 是一个强大而实用的工具,为开发高效的 JSP 应用程序提供了坚实的基础。无论您是新手还是经验丰富的开发者,都能从中受益。尝试一下吧,体验优雅的 JSP 开发方式!

sling-org-apache-sling-scripting-jsp-jstlApache Sling Scripting JSP Standard Tag Library项目地址:https://gitcode.com/gh_mirrors/sl/sling-org-apache-sling-scripting-jsp-jstl

  • 3
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

黎杉娜Torrent

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值